| Term |
larval fat of adult |
ID (Ontology) |
FBbt:00003211 (Fly Anatomy) |
| Definition |
Adipose tissue that is found in the late pupa or early adult that is derived largely from dissociated larval fat cells (Bate, 1993; Nelliot et al., 2006). It degenerates a few days post-eclosion (Bate, 1993).[ FlyBase:FBrf0064793 FlyBase:FBrf0193562 ] |
| Also Known As |
"deep adult fat mass" |
